Original Description
Thomas William Morley’s Old Town, Hastings captures the nostalgic charm of a historic English seaside town with remarkable atmospheric depth. Painted in the late 19th or early 20th century, the work exemplifies Morley’s affinity for maritime scenes, blending realism with subtle impressionistic touches to evoke the quiet vitality of Hastings' old fishing quarter. The composition likely features timber-framed houses, winding streets, and perhaps fishing boats, rendered in muted yet warm tones that convey both the ruggedness and warmth of coastal life. As part of the broader British landscape tradition, Morley’s piece reflects the era’s fascination with regional identity and picturesque decay, offering a bridge between Victorian romanticism and early modern observational painting. Though less widely known than Turner or Constable, Morley’s works hold historical value for their documentation of vanishing coastal communities.
